Benefits of Sheet Metal Fence Panels
1. Durability One of the standout features of sheet metal is its robustness. Unlike traditional wooden fences that may warp, rot, or succumb to pest infestations, metal panels can withstand harsh weather conditions, including heavy rain, snow, and extreme heat. This resilience ensures that your fence will last for many years with minimal upkeep.
2. Low Maintenance Sheet metal fences require very little care compared to other fencing materials. A simple wash with soap and water once or twice a year is usually sufficient to keep them looking new. Additionally, many metal panels come with a protective coating that helps to resist rust and corrosion, further decreasing the need for maintenance.
3. Aesthetic Appeal Sheet metal panels offer a sleek, modern look that can enhance the visual appeal of any property. Available in various colors and finishes, including galvanized, painted, and powder-coated options, you're sure to find a style that complements your home or business aesthetic.
4. Security The solidity of sheet metal provides an excellent barrier against intrusions. For properties that require enhanced security measures, such as commercial spaces, these panels can be a deterrent to break-ins and vandalism, making them an optimal choice for anyone looking to protect their assets.
5. Versatility Sheet metal fence panels can be customized to meet specific needs and preferences. They can be used in various applications, from residential yards to industrial sites, and can be tailored in height, thickness, and design.
Types of Sheet Metal Fence Panels
- Corrugated Metal Panels Known for their ribbed design, corrugated metal panels are lightweight yet strong. They offer a rustic look and are popular for agricultural use or contemporary fencing.
- Flat Metal Panels For a more modern and streamlined appearance, flat panels are an excellent choice. They can be used in various orientations and often come with decorative finishes to enhance aesthetics.
- Composite Metal Panels These panels combine metal with other materials, such as wood or plastic, to create a visually appealing design while retaining the durability of metal. They are available in a variety of styles and textures.
Installation Tips
1. Preparation Before you begin installation, check local building codes and zoning regulations to ensure compliance. This step is crucial as it may dictate the allowable height, design, and materials used.
2. Get Help While it is possible to install a sheet metal fence on your own, enlisting the help of a professional can save time and ensure an accurate installation. A skilled installer will also guarantee that the necessary materials are provided and cut to size correctly.
3. Post Installation Make sure to set your fence posts securely in concrete for added stability, especially if you are in a windy area. The depth of your post holes will depend on fence height, but a general guideline is to bury one-third of the post length.
4. Regular Inspections Once the fence is installed, it’s wise to regularly inspect it for any signs of damage, rust, or wear, especially after severe weather. Catching any issues early can prolong the life of your fence.
